请给出JSTL里面的c:catch标签的例子
c:catch标签
马克- to-win:马克 java社区:防盗版实名手机尾号: 73203。
完成类似java的try catch的功能:
例 2.2.4
<%@ page contentType="text/html; charset=GBK"%>
<%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c"%>
<html>
<body>
<c:catch var="myex">
<%
double j = 5 / 0;
%>
</c:catch>
<hr>
异常注意写成5.8/0,就没异常了,(因为是double型的):
<c:out value="${myex}" />
</body>
</html>
运行jsp后,浏览器中输出结果是:
异常注意写成5.8/0,就没异常了,(因为是double型的): java.lang.ArithmeticException: / by zero